AVE MARIA, Fla. --- The 2015 Football All-Sun Conference teams and special award honorees were announced by the Sun Conference office Monday afternoon. The All-Conference teams featured 25 first team selections and 26 second team honorees. The All-Conference teams are determined by a vote of the league’s coaches.
Point University’s Charles Fortis was named the 2015 Sun Conference Player of the Year. The senior quarterback out of Redlands, Calif., threw for 2,817 yards and amassed 36 total touchdowns (32 passing, 4 rushing). He completed 61.8 percent of his passes on the season as he led Point to the conference’s first ever appearance in the NAIA Football Championship Series tournament. Fortis ranked ninth in the NAIA in both pass efficiency (153.2) and total passing (2,817 yards).
Coach Mike McCarty earned Coach of the Year honors after leading Point to a 9-2 regular season record and a perfect 5-0 mark against Sun Conference opponents. The Skyhawks, a year off of finishing 0-9 overall and 0-5 in TSC play, dominated Sun Conference opponents in 2015, winning four of their five conference games by 27 points or more. Point finished the regular season ranked 17th in the NAIA Football Coaches’ Top 25 Poll and earned the program’s first invitation to the NAIA Football Championship Series tournament.
Ave Maria’s Sebastian Woods-Mariano was this season’s Champions of Character award recipient. The junior offensive lineman from Winter Park, Fla., has been heavily involved this season in several community outreach programs such as 1-by-1 Leadership, Habitat for Humanity, and Meals 4 Hope. He has also spent time as a volunteer assistant coach for a local high school’s varsity football team and grade school girl’s basketball team.
The league also announced the Academic All-Conference team on Monday, which included 18 football student-athletes. To be eligible for Academic All-Conference recognition, a student-athlete must be a sophomore or higher with a 3.5 or better cumulative grade point average.
